Ada mayor Friday chamber breakfast speaker; human resource workshop follows breakfast
The Bluffton Area Chamber of Commerce will hold two events open to the public on Friday, Nov. 8. Those events include the monthly chamber breakfast followed by a workshop on human resources.
David Retterer, mayor of Ada, is the guest speaker at the breakfast. He is an associate professor of mathematics and computer science at Ohio Northern University. His wife, Deb, is a pharmacist at Greg's Pharmacy, Bluffton.
All events take place in the third floor of the town hall. Jeanne’s Kitchen is the breakfast provider. Serving for the free breakfast is from 7 to 7:30 a.m. The chamber meeting, which is open to the public, starts at 7:30 a.m.
The meeting will recognize members of the Bluffton American Legion Post 384 who are Korean War veterans. Jerry Cupples and John Wagner assisted the chamber in bringing this recognition together in conjunction with Veterans Day.

8:45 a.m. human resources workshop
Following the breakfast is a free workshop titled “What you don’t know you don’t know about human resources.” Sally Siferd, PHR, will lead the workshop.
Siferd has been a certified Professional in Human Resources since 1997. Prior to coming to Bluffton University, she was the owner of a human resources consulting business, HR House Call, LLC, for nearly four years. She helped small businesses who did not have someone on staff dedicated to human resource issues.
Siferd found that small business owners and professional organizations are great entrepreneurs, but had limited knowledge of the laws governing employers and the expectations of today's employees. She will share some insight and tips for small business owners at the workshop.
